Revamp creates jobs

A SOUTH Belfast hotel will reopen next month after an investment of around £3.5m creating up to 10 new jobs. The four-star family-owned Malone Lodge Hotel is targeting the corporate, wedding and tourist market with the addition of an executive wing, a new 90-seater restaurant, underground car park and suite for civil marriage ceremonies. Students to fly high thanks to £6m MSc fund

A NEW bursary fund will provide future work opportunities for up to 500 graduates and employees. The £6million UK-wide scheme will pay for the new graduates and employees to study Masters (MSc) level degrees in aerospace engineering. Belfast Charity Has 21 Reasons To Celebrate…

A BELFAST-based charity which has helped thousands of people towards employment and learning is celebrating its 21 anniversary this year. Springboard Opportunities Ltd works with communities across cultures, religions and borders and is best known for its Wider Horizons programme, which supports young unemployed adults from disadvantaged backgrounds.
